Digitization is not a new phenomenon. What's more, since
programming languages were introduced in the mid-20th century, benefits have
been found for many industries by transforming their core values, and real
estate is no exception.
Today, much of the processes in the real estate sector have
ceased to be carried out in the traditional way, and have instead turned
towards digitization. This transformation has occurred at an accelerated pace,
and it is only a matter of time before all the companies in the sector carry
out their procedures 100% online .
In fact, according to a report prepared by Salesforce ,
currently more than 70% of real estate companies in Spain are in the phase of
digital transformation and process automation.
In the same way that both landlords and tenants make intensive use of the internet to advertise and search for a flat respectively, real estate agents also have online tools that allow them to serve digital consumers at the precise time and place where they need to be served.
7 digital tools for real estate agents
In this post we review some of the basic tools that a
digital real estate agent needs:
1. Magic Plan
This tool allows to elaborate the precise plan of a house by
means of the capture of images. No technical knowledge or additional tools are
required. You just have to take photos of each room and the floor plan is built
automatically and interactively.
Once the plan is built, the application allows you to send it by email to the client, so that they can get a more specific idea of what the floor is like and how they could make the best use of the space.
2. Clickmeeting
The ubiquity of the real estate agent is very possible
thanks to Clickmeeting, a videoconferencing tool that facilitates meetings ,
both with clients and colleagues, anytime and anywhere.
In addition, the ability to share documents and screen with clients in real time, allows you to jointly review the most important points of a contract and resolve any questions instantly.
3. GoolZoom
Property appraisal tool created with Google Maps technology
and that offers even more data than the Cadastre website, the official search
tool for cadastral references in Spain. GoolZoom offers 3 basic
functionalities: maps, real estate and data.
The real estate functionality allows you to select an area in which to check which flats, houses, offices, premises, rooms or garages are for sale or for rent. In addition to these three functions, GoolZoom offers a multitude of filters, map, cadastre and census data, property valuation reports, and more.

5. Camu
The quality of the photos of a home is key to making an
excellent first impression and motivating the desire to visit it in person.
Camu is an application that facilitates the capture of high quality photos with a powerful camera whose interface is very easy to use. Although it is a tool designed for mobile creatives, real estate agents can also take advantage of it and take stunning photos of any property.
6. Canva
To create graphic compositions such as web banners,
presentations, brochures, flyers, posters or any other element that requires
design with images or logos, Canva is the ideal tool.
You do not need to have any notion of graphic design or be especially creative to use it, since it offers a multitude of formats and templates that can be easily combined. To make your designs, with Canva you can use both your own photos and buy images within the same platform.
7. Signaturit
Electronic signature solution in the real estate sector
allows you to send documents to sign to any email account , so that the
presence of the client is no longer required to close a real estate transaction
.
With Signaturit you save management time - print documentation, scan it and send it to be signed - and the documents signed through our platform are legally valid , both in the European Union and in the United States.
